By wildwildwes • Jul 16th, 2008 • Category: Feature Story, Throwdown Results, WK Hometown ThrowdownsOur HTTD #4 was yet another great success at the USNWC on July 5. The weather was much more pleasant than event #3. Temps were in the low 80’s and partly cloudy conditions were nice for a break from the sun. The whitewater park got a good rain the night before which got the pool level up 6” to bring “Biscuits and Gravy” back in for play! Plus the water temps were quite a bit cooler to add some additional refreshment to the day. Despite the holiday weekend, we still had another good turn out of 22 competitors!

It was great to have several of our Men’s K-1A leaders back from CO to compete! They provided some very fun entertainment in and out of the hole. Once again, everyone who competed or volunteered for this event went home with prizes and swag thanks to all of our great sponsors!

We have now completed 4 of the 5 events in our Hometown Throwdown Series. We have not much change in the leader board since event #3. Will this hold true for Event #5 too or will the other close competitors step it up in the final event to take away the gold from the current leaders… Who knows??? We will only find out the answers when the sun sets on event #5…
Current leader highlights:
- Chris Stafford has increased his commanding lead in the Men’s K-1A overall standings. Fergus is his closest competitor, but over 60 points down from Chris. Fergus could easily steal away the series competition though if Chris is a no show for event #5. If Chris does show up, Fergus will have his work cut out for him to catch up with Chris. This will be a very entertain division to watch in the final Throwdown!
- Yours truly (Wesley R. Bradley) continues to hold the lead for the Men’s K-1B overall standings. However the competition is close with Burt and Ben closing in on my overall score. I will have to step it up in the final event if I want to keep Ben or Burt from stealing my glory. So bring the heat Boys in Event #5! This will be your last chance…
- Sarah Harper is still completely dominating the competition in the Woman’s K-1 overall standings! She is the only competitor in the series to win 3 events to date. Congrats Sarah!
- Since we had no Juniors to compete in Event #4 we still currently have a tie for 1st place in the Juniors overall standings between Matt Wright & Michal Smolen. Event #5 should be very interesting to watch which one of these young guns will come out as the Jr. leader… or will they both be no shows again and another Jr. steal the victory???
- Casey officially now has some competition to deal with the addition of two new C-1 participants. Garret can easily steal away his title in the final throwdown… I hope you 3 can make it to the final event to duel it out!
